KISS principle

/kɪs ˈprɪnsəpəl/ キス プリンシプル

1. 「Keep It Simple, Stupid」の頭字語で、設計や開発において物事を不必要に複雑にせず、シンプルに保つべきだという原則。

「Keep It Simple, Stupid」の略で、システム設計、プログラミング、執筆など、様々な分野において不必要な複雑さを排除し、可能な限りシンプルにすることを目指す原則です。シンプルであるほど、理解しやすく、使いやすく、エラーが少なくなり、保守も容易になるという考え方に基づいています。
Always remember the KISS principle when designing software. (ソフトウェアを設計する際は、常にKISS原則を覚えておいてください。)
関連
design philosophy
agile development
Don't Repeat Yourself (DRY)
You Ain't Gonna Need It (YAGNI)